How We Handle Broken Pipe Water Removal
When you call us, our team springs into action to reduce the damage. We use specialized equipment to remove standing water, dry out your home, and prevent further damage. Our process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and identify potential safety hazards.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use heavy-duty p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water from your home. Our technicians will work efficiently to reduce the time and cost of the process.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ry out your home and prevent mold growth. Our technicians will monitor the drying process to ensure everything is d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ll clean and sanitize all surfaces and materials affected by the water damage. Our technicians will use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Once the cleaning and sanitizing process is complete, our technicians will begin the restoration and repair process. We’ll work with you to ensure your home is restored to its original condition.

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ost in White Settlement, TX
The cost of broken pipe water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in White Settlement, TX.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ected |
| Restoration and repair |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ected |
| Equipment rental and usage | $100 – $500 | Duration of job, type of equipment used |
| Permits and inspections | $50 – $200 | Local regulations, type of work required |
| Disinfecting and deodorizing | $100 – $300 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ected |
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and can v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We’ll provide you with a more accurate estimate after assessing the damage and developing a plan for your home.
